YoVDO

Simple Next.js & React Authentication With Clerk

Offered By: Traversy Media via YouTube

Tags

Next.js Courses Web Development Courses React Courses User Interface Design Courses Clerk Courses

Course Description

Overview

Save Big on Coursera Plus. 7,000+ courses at $160 off. Limited Time Only!
Learn to build a robust authentication system for Next.js applications using Clerk in this comprehensive 50-minute tutorial. Explore the process of setting up Clerk, implementing a Clerk Provider, creating a header component, and protecting pages with middleware. Discover how to create sign-in pages, add conditional header links, and integrate UserButton and UserProfile components. Dive into email signup and verification, theme customization, and building a custom sign-up flow with form UI. Master handling form submissions and email verification to create a secure and user-friendly authentication system for your Next.js projects.

Syllabus

- Intro
- Project Demo
- Next.js Setup
- Install & Setup Clerk
- Clerk Provider
- Header Component
- Protecting Pages - middleware.js
- .env routes
- Sign In Page
- Conditional Header Links
- UserButton Component
- UserProfile Component
- Email Signup & Verification Code
- Using Themes
- Start Custom Sign Up Flow
- Custom Form UI
- Handle Submit
- Email Verification
- Conclusion


Taught by

Traversy Media

Related Courses

Text-to-Post Web App Tutorial - Twilio, Convex, Clerk, React, and TypeScript
Learn With Jason via YouTube
Build a Viral Event Sharing Page - Web Dev Challenge
Learn With Jason via YouTube
Build and Deploy a Next-Gen AI SaaS Platform with Next.js and Convex
JavaScript Mastery via YouTube
Build an Expense Tracker with Next.js, TypeScript, Prisma, Neon, and Clerk
Traversy Media via YouTube
Implementing Clerk Authentication in Astro without Client-Side JavaScript
Learn With Jason via YouTube